Sorry microbob,

Straddle is a stock market term mostly.

In a 2 team dip/teaser, you get to +6.5 to 2 teams. With the line at MIA +1, if you dip both teams, you get the spread to MIA +7.5 and PIT +5.5. It's also known as a teaser bet.

Back in years past, I used to 3 team dip both teams and the over for every monday night game. I had a nice win-rate with it since all monday night games are rigged to be high scoring close game for ratings. That's what gave me the idea.

If you plug in different values for the 2 extra bets, you can come up with some great numbers that I think are a better value than buying your way to -7.5.
